Studies and recommends changes to the City's Comprehensive Plan and reviews all site plans to ensure consistency with the Plan. Annually, the commission prepares and revises a five-year capital improvements program, including capital budget recommendations. The Planning Commission makes recommendations on the preservation of historical landmarks, and design of public bridges, street fixtures, and other public structures and appurtenances. The Planning Commission advises the City Council and the City Manager.

Meeting Schedule
Meets at 7:45 p.m. the first and third Monday of each month in City Hall Council Chambers, 2nd Floor, 300 Park Avenue. (Except in January, February, and September when one or more meetings are held on Tuesday because the regular meeting date is a holiday.)  Watch Planning Commisson Meetings Online.

Member Information
The seven-member Commission is appointed by the City Council for four-year terms. Each member is paid $100 monthly and the Chair is paid $150 monthly.
